Output 381088a08cb980845f29c3441d442f626ba90df26c1add633750f40edaeff421:6

value
180500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ab9623b461d68e7372bdbed33afe7f6d696b4c9a OP_EQUAL
address
3HLHLDieqkJ3dpLMpjsJgvjMG8DmpvYWdX
transaction
381088a08cb980845f29c3441d442f626ba90df26c1add633750f40edaeff421
spent
true